- PRATT, Pamela (nee Meyer)
Formerly of Cambridge (P). Peacefully, in her home, in St. Catharines, after a courageous battle with cancer, on Thursday, Nov. 14, 2002. Pam, loving and devoted mother, is survived by her children, Heather Pratt (Larry Janzen) of St. Catharines, Brian Pratt (Marjorie) of Huntsville, Sharon Chelmecki (Stan) of Rockwood and Carolyn Tripp (James) of Warminster. She will be sadly missed by her grandchildren, Jonathan, Christopher, Kevin. Alyssa and Holly. Dear daughter of IvaDelle Meyer, formerly of Cambridge; sister of Bill Meyers (Joan) of Southhampton and aunt to Cathy Ross (Brian) and Bill Meyers (Susan). Sincere appreciation to Karolina Vesela and to Pam's many caring friends. Their loving support and generous natures were integral in providing the comfort and spiritual peace needed in her final days. Pam retired from the College of Education at Brock University in June 2001, where she worked for over 20 years. She had also been a longtime member of Queen St. Baptist Church.
